    Came here for the first time with my family. We came during lunch on a Thursday. I was looking forward to eating crab legs, but I didn't know they only serve it on Saturdays per one of the waitresses. Anyways, we got the lunch buffet and for 3 people, it was less than $40. Even if the food isn't high quality food, that's a very good deal to smash as much as you'd like lol. They had a variety of selections from sushi, fried foods, soups, Chinese food, salad and dessert bar, boils, etc. They even had a worker stir-frying raw meats and veggies by request. Staff are friendly and fast. They sat us down fast, removed our empty plates, and refilled our water cups. Lots of tables to dine on and lots of parking as well. Overall, pretty clean restaurant. I was worried because I read some awful reviews about flies, etc.
